Interventional Neurology and critical care
Interventional Neurology is a specialized field of neurology that focuses on diagnosing and treating neurological conditions through minimally invasive procedures. This innovative approach combines advanced imaging techniques with catheter-based interventions to address complex neurological disorders, offering patients effective treatment options with reduced recovery times and minimized risks compared to traditional surgery.
Interventional Neurologists are experts in performing endovascular procedures to treat a variety of conditions affecting the brain, spinal cord, and blood vessels of the nervous system. These procedures are typically performed through small incisions or catheter insertions, using advanced imaging technologies such as angiography, CT, or MRI to guide the interventions. Key procedures in this field include carotid artery stenting, cerebral angioplasty, and endovascular coil embolization for conditions such as aneurysms, arteriovenous malformations (AVMs), and acute ischemic stroke.
One of the primary conditions managed by Interventional Neurologists is acute ischemic stroke, where they perform thrombectomy to remove blood clots from the brains blood vessels. This life-saving procedure can significantly reduce the impact of stroke and improve outcomes when performed promptly. Interventional Neurologists work closely with a multidisciplinary team, including emergency physicians, radiologists, and rehabilitation specialists, to ensure comprehensive care for stroke patients.
In addition to stroke management, Interventional Neurologists address chronic conditions such as chronic migraine, intracranial aneurysms, and vascular malformations. They utilize targeted interventions to manage symptoms, reduce complications, and improve patients quality of life. For example, they may use embolization techniques to treat aneurysms or AVMs, effectively reducing the risk of bleeding and other complications.
Interventional Neurologists also play a role in preoperative planning and postoperative care. They collaborate with neurosurgeons and other specialists to plan and execute interventions that complement surgical procedures or provide alternatives to traditional surgery. They monitor patients progress, manage any complications, and adjust treatment plans as necessary to optimize outcomes.
Patient education and support are integral to their practice. Interventional Neurologists provide detailed information about procedures, including potential risks, benefits, and recovery expectations. They work with patients and their families to ensure they understand the treatment options and are prepared for the procedural and postoperative aspects of care.
